WHO WE ARE

Samsara (NYSE: IOT) is the pioneer of the Connected Operations™ Cloud, which is a platform that enables organizations that depend on physical operations to harness Internet of Things (IoT) data to develop actionable insights and improve their operations. At Samsara, we are helping improve the safety, efficiency and sustainability of the physical operations that power our global economy. Representing more than 40% of global GDP, these industries are the infrastructure of our planet, including agriculture, construction, field services, transportation, and manufacturing — and we are excited to help digitally transform their operations at scale.
Working at Samsara means you’ll help define the future of physical operations and be on a team that’s shaping an exciting array of product solutions, including Video-Based Safety, Vehicle Telematics, Apps and Driver Workflows, Equipment Monitoring, and Site Visibility. ABOUT THE ROLE:

We are looking for a creative, impact-driven senior growth marketer to join the team to help us acquire new customers. The right candidate is a strategic thinker who is excited to optimize the marketing and sales funnel and find new avenues for growth. This role is key to the growth of the business and to Samsara’s success.

IN THIS ROLE, YOU WILL:

  • Acquire customers through digital channels and be directly responsible for helping the company meet its growth goals
  • Optimize the entire conversion funnel and continuously experiment with bidding strategies, targeting, messaging, ad creative, and landing pages to drive incremental pipeline
  • Be a business owner for your channels: manage budgets and forecasts, measure performance, and optimize for results
  • Support new areas of growth for the company by launching channels and campaigns for new geographies, product lines, and industries
  • Champion, role model, and embed Samsara’s cultural principles (Focus on Customer Success, Build for the Long Term, Adopt a Growth Mindset, Be Inclusive, Win as a Team) as we scale globally and across new offices

M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S FOR THE ROLE:

  • 5+ years of experience in an analytical role at a high growth technology company, with at least 3 years of digital lead generation experience
  • Previous experience directly managing Google Ads for lead generation
  • Proven experience delivering on pipeline generation targets at scale, managing a 7+ figure annual budget within spend efficiency thresholds
  • Strong communication and project management skills, with a track record of maintaining a high velocity of experimentation across channels
  • Experience working cross-functionally with sales, product, and marketing teams to launch and optimize lead sources tailored to specific products and regions
  • Bachelor’s degree or foreign equivalent, ideally in economics, mathematics, finance, or other quantitative field
